Performance counts! Introducing the Flexibôl© - "being flexible under the roof."
What is the Flexibôl? Latin: Flexibilis, from flectó ("I bend, curve) and bôl ("sphere, ball, globe, orb").
Flexibôl is a third-generation offspring product of the Hoffman's Balls foam-glass genre, a man-made aggregate produced for its strength, fire, water-and-sound resistance, and its excellent insulation properties. An engineered spherical ball (2mm to 25mm as required through specifications) filled with air or CO2, the Flexibôl resists biaxial bending and removes dead loads unlike other solutions, while giving benefits that others cannot. Using recyclate material feed stock, Flexibôl is specifically produced for concrete applications replacing other aggregates without the use of ordinary Portland cement, in conjunction with our sustainable binder, the loads, shear and stress it can withstand is like no other.
